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ction

Ignoring standing water in your home can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s you need standing water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show standing water and m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to address the issue immediately.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or bubble. If you notice any changes in your walls, it’s time to call our team.

Unexplained Stains or Discoloration

Unexplained st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can show water damage. If you notice any unusual marks, it’s time to investigate further.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a more significant issue.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to address the problem quickly.

Water Damage Under Appliances

Water damage under appliances like dishwashers, washing machines, or refrigerators can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ice any water damage under your appliances, it’s time to call our team.

Standing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ak under sink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self and clean up the water.
Large water leak in basement No Yes You’ll need professional equipment to extract the water and dry out the area.
Water damage under refrigerator No Yes You’ll need to remove the appliance and dry out the area, which needs professional expertise.
Musty odor in entire house No Yes You’ll need to identify and address the source of the odor, which may need professional equipment and expertise.
Water damage in multiple rooms No Yes You’ll need professional help to contain and extract the water, as well as dry out the affected areas.
Water damage in crawl space No Yes You’ll need professional equipment and expertise to access and dry out the crawl space.

Standing Water Extraction Cost In Milford, MA

The cost of standing water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Milford, MA.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Estimate $100 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and number of equipment units needed
Final Inspection and Cleanup $500 – $1,000 Complexity of cleanup and number of equipment units needed
More Services (e.g., mold remediation) $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age and number of services required

Common Questions About Standing Water Extraction

Q: How long does it take to extract water from my home?

A: The time it takes to extract water from your home dep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work quickly to contain and extract the water, but the drying process may take several days to complete.

Q: Will you restore my home to its original condition?

A: Our team will work to restore your home to its original condition, but in some cases, it may not be possible to completely restore the affected area. We’ll discuss the options with you and provide a detailed estimate for the work.

Q: Do you offer emergency services for standing water extraction?

A: Yes, we offer emergency services for standing water extraction. If you’re experiencing an emergency, call our team immediately, and we’ll dispatch a crew to your location as quickly as possible.

Q: How do I prevent standing water in my home?

A: To prevent standing water in your home, make sure to check your pipes regularly for leaks, keep your gutters clean, and address any water damage quickly. You should also consider installing a sump pump or French drain in areas prone to water accumulation.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of standing water extraction?

A: It’s possible that your insurance may cover the cost of standing water extraction, but it depends on the specifics of your policy. We recommend contacting your insurance provider to discuss your coverage and options.
